Temple Downs Wichita State for Season Sweep

PHILADELPHIA – Temple knocked down 10 three-pointers and used a game-sealing 9-0 run at the end of the third quarter to defeat Wichita State, 68-52, at McGonigle Hall Saturday afternoon.

Wichita State (11-17, 4-11) lost its fourth straight game and finished the season 0-2 against the Owls. The Shockers missed 12 of their 13 three-point attempts and shot 37 percent for the game.

Temple (10-18, 6-9) poured in 10 triples in 27 tries, while hitting 39.4 percent from the field.
